We prove existence and uniqueness of weak solutions to certain abstract evolutionary integro-differential equations in Hilbert spaces, including evolution equations of fractional order less than 1. Our results apply, e.g., to parabolic partial integro-differential equations in divergence form with merely bounded and measurable coefficients. AMS subject classification: 45N05, 45K05
